Program Manager Clinical Research - Dept. of Surgery
Creighton University is seeking to hire a Program Manager for the Department of Surgery. This role manages and oversees the administration of programs for the School of Medicine in Clinical Research, facilitating research operations and ensuring compliance with institutional requirements.

Responsibilities
Assist students, residents, fellows, faculty, and non-faculty in facilitating and coordinating day-to-day operations for investigator-initiated research projects
Track and monitor project timelines, deliverables, and milestones including study enrollment
Facilitate researchers/faculty in getting access to bio statistical analysis/data collection
Prepare investigator (student, resident, fellow, faculty, non-faculty) initiated protocols and study related materials to Institutional Review Board (IRB)
Maintain paper and electronic study documents, manage files, and provide written communication to faculty investigators to facilitate research performed at Creighton University
Facilitate collaboration among researchers within the institution and community-based research initiative
Support the preparation of abstracts, manuscripts, and presentations
Proofread/edit/and provide grant writing assistance including multidisciplinary proposals
Edit draft proposals to create highly competitive submissions and review proposal feedback for potential re-submission opportunities and/or submission to other grant agencies
Connect scientists to resources
Track and coordinate participation in ongoing funding opportunities
Assist various department staff in writing periodic reports to comply with grant requirements
Coordinate annual renewal applications, protocol amendments, and prepare expedited IRB notification of protocol violations and ensure adherence to IRB, regulatory and institutional requirements
Qualification
Required
Ability to translate complex scientific information into practical communications
Ability to provide guidance and instruction to residency coordinators and program directors
Must be skilled at problem solving and diplomatically handling problems of a sensitive and/or confidential nature
Proficiency in MS Office Suite to include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Outlook
Preferred
Bachelor's Degree in Health Administration, Business Administration, or related field is preferred
2 + years of related experience. IRB submission background and understanding of the different types of research preferred
